Hey all. Less than a year ago, I purchased a really nice scalper pattern knife from Charlie at Backwoods Magazine. I have asked him my question and he is unable to help. The knife is flat carbon bladed with a shallow taper near the sharpened edge. I came with a one-piece walnut handle that was slotted for the blade with one rivet hole. The knife when it came to me had a copper band around the blade end of the handle. Well, I am changin' out ye handle to a crown antler. The knife (without handle) is 10 1/4" long with an 8" x 1 1/8" blade and a tang of 2 1/8" x 1" with the rivet hole in the rear of the tang and in the lower corner. The knife had lettering (mostly under the original handle) reading SPARTANKI(H or N)AIL. Anyone have any ideas about the origin of this knife?
